BACKGROUND

The MMX-81C "Ocelot" Series Ground Assault Mobile Frame is the Nerimian Defense Initiative's response to the modern-day battlefield. The Ocelot is a powerhouse in its own right, but it works best when supported by powered armor infantry and supporting vehicles. The Ocelot is capable of low-altitude flight using its powerful plasma impulse engines, which gives it a great deal of versatility on the battlefield.

The Ocelot's ability to withstand damage is only parallel by its larger counterpart, the Shatterstar. The neutronium is interleaved with layers of mercurite, which prevents the passage of volatile electromagnetic radiation and high-energy radiation (gamma rays) that could harm the electronic systems or the pilot. The outer layer of armor is the advanced Xintium alloy, which in addition to having incredible resistance to heat (90,000 degrees Celcius), concussive force (2,000,000 pounds per square inch), and directed-energy weaponry, has an abnormal nuclear force in the molecules that repairs damaged molecular bonds over time, meaning the armor is incredibly resilient to damage. In field tests, the survivability of the unit through the most dire of combat situations has made it one of the most reliable combat units available.

Weaponry, as always, is the true striking power of any combat unit. The Ocelot wields two progressive blades forged from the super-strong and dense metallic alloy of xentrotium, which is further strengthened by using Dikoting technologies (adding a thin layer of diamond over the metal). These blades can shear through the toughest alloys known with a single swipe, the vibrating motion of the blades capable of turning grazes into severe lacerations. Meanwhile, twin 40mm pulse particle cannons that are known to take out every existing advanced armor vehicle and heavily armored sea combat vessel in a matter of seconds. A chest-mounted 105 mm disruptor cannon unleashes phased energy bolts that literally shatter the molecular bonds of a target once it strikes, which makes it the ideal anti-mecha weapon. External weapons systems include the large NXT-04 Plasma Cannon which packs capital ship firepower in a mobile frame class package. Two guided mortar launchers are mounted on the back of the mecha, which launch long-range guided mortars at extreme ranges that can home in on enemy radar or infrared signatures. Warheads range from conventional high-explosive fragmentation, armor-piercing, or 5 KT tactical nuclear warheads.

Propulsion systems on the Ocelot consist of Argus Millitech's revolutionary KX Series plasma-impulse engines, which draw in air from the surrounding environment and convert it to plasma, which in turn powers the enormous engines of the assault mecha. For maneuverability in aerial combat, several vernier thrusters coupled with inertial nullification systems allow the Ocelot to move with unprecedented agility for a combat unit its size.

Ultimately, the Ocelot is pound-for-pound the most versatile combat unit in its class, capable of leading the charge in assaults against enemy installations and supporting other ATAC units in the field.

WEAPON SYSTEMS:

  1. ARC-20 40MM PULSE CANNONS (2): High-intensity energy pulse cannon mounted on either side of the head unit of the powered armor. Fires in rapid pulses of 10 megajoules each. Each pulse is actually a dense packet of highly-charged particle energy ('annihilation discs'). Upon impact with a target, the energy is unleashed fully upon a single part of the target's armor structure, totally breaking down the molecular bonds of the armor upon the impact point and severely weakening bonds across the surface of the target. Multiple hits will blast through some of the most resilient armors with little or no effort.
  2. PROGRESSIVE BLADES (2): The Ocelot's primary close-range weapons are a set of forearm-mounted progressive vibrational blades that can be extended outwards to deal extreme damage against enemy units. Each blade is treated with Dikote™, a process that deposits a thin diamond film on any solid surface. Small volumes of methane gas are mixed with hydrogen gas and subjected to powerful microwave beams. The end result is a blade that in addition to the natural integrity of the metal used, adds increased structural strength to the weapon.
  3. PHOENIX ARMS NXT-04 PLASMA RIFLE: For a main external weapon, the Ocelot wields Phoenix Arms' NXT-04 Plasma Rifle, which is the equivalent of a starship class medium plasma cannon. The rifle carries enough plasma in the clip to fire 60 shots before needing to be recharged.
  4. GUIDED MORTAR LAUNCHERS (2): Two heavy guided mortars are mounted on the back of the mecha that can launch the 355mm "Armadillo" guided mortar at extreme range. Each mortar is guided via radar, infrared, or even laser targeting (from a spotter on the ground). The Acolyte mortar can carry a variety of warheads, including high-explosive fragmentation, high-explosive antitank (HEAT), plasma warheads, tactical nuclear warheads, and special "Flashlight" Vircator warheads.
  5. ARGUS MILITECH F-2C SERIES 105mm DISRUPTOR CANNON (1): The F-2C Disruptor Cannon is an advanced phasor weapon that not only phases the energy so it can pass through force-fields uninhibited, but when the weapon strikes its target, it disrupts the molecular cohesion of the target, totally shattering molecular bonds and causing the weakening of molecular bonds all across the structure of the target. Against soft targets, the disruptor turns targets into simple ash with the energy dispersion of the weapon.
